  6. The distance between the bases is usually different (this might not be a factor in youth games). The pitch is delivered in an underhanded motion in softball, but overhand or sidearm in baseball. Bats are slightly different for softball (more surface area). Other rule deviations may not apply to youth games, but come in to play at the high school level.

  12. ^There is a lot of confusion not just with the translation from German to English, but also that terminology can mean different things to different people. Even a simply term like derail. Some people will define derailment as any wheels leaving the track and coming to rest on another surface, while others may define derailment as the act of the whole vehicle (all cars) leaving the track. Emergency Brake is another term that there is confusion around. Some are taking "emergency brake" to mean that the ride was engineered to stop the train when some wheels left the track, Some are interpreting it to mean that someone manually hit a button to brake the train due to an emergency. Some can interpret it to mean the train came to a grinding stop due to the emergency situation, such as metal dragging on metal causing friction and an "emergency" stop. Right now there is no clarity, so you are not the only one confused.

  22. Although mapping systems might say 4.5 hours from Newark to Woburn, it could be closer to 6.5 hours at that time of day with the routes they suggest.. Do not follow any directions that take you through Manhattan (I-95 over the George Washington Bridge) are through White Plains (I-287 over the Tappan Zee Bridge). Those bridges can add up to 2 hours to your trip due to rush hour traffic. The better option will be 30 miles longer but should get you to Woburn in 5 - 5.5 hours. This route involves going north on the Garden State Parkway, which turns into the New York State Thruway and continue going north, then go East on I-84, Then I-90 East towards Boston, then you are safe following any route that is provided to get you to the hotel in Woburn
